Cyclone Nivar brings heavy rainfall to Chennai; PM Modi dials TN, Puducherry CMs, assures full support

Amid the Cyclone Nivar warning, the Indian Meteorological Department (IMD) on Tuesday predicted heavy to very heavy rainfall in four Tamil Nadu districts in the next 24 hours. Chennai, Kanchipuram, Thiruvallur and Chengalpet are the four districts. In its weather update, the IMD said that as per latest observations, intense convective clouds present over Chennai and adjoining areas of Thiruvallur, Chengalpattu and Kanchipuram districts have the potential to cause heavy to very heavy rainfall during the next 24 hours.
